Calculate the potential of hydrogen electrode in contact with a solution whose pH is 10.

Text Solution

Verified by Experts

Given: `Ph=10`
Asked (a) `E_(H^(+)//H_(2))=?`
(b). `E_(cell)^(0)=?`
formula used: (a). `E_(el)=E_(el)^(@)-(0.0591)/(n)log((["product"])/(["reactant"]))`
Explanation: `E_(el)=E_(el)=` electrode potential of single electrode
`E_(el)^(@)=` Standard electrode potential of single electrode.
Substitutio and calculation:
`Ph=10implies[H^(+)]=10^(-10)molL^(-1)`
`E_(H^(+)//H_(2))=E_(H^(+)//H_(2))-(0.0591)/(1)log((1)/([H^(+)])`
`=0-(0.0591)/(1)log((1)/(10^(-10))=E_(H^(+)//H_(2))=-0.591V`
